About

American Advanced Technicians Institute is a higher education institution located in Miami-Dade County, FL. In 2019, the most popular Less than 1 Year Postsecondary Certificate concentrations at American Advanced Technicians Institute were General Vehicle Maintenance & Repair Technologies (28 degrees awarded) and Automobile Mechanics Technology (6 degrees).

In 2024, 8 degrees were awarded across all undergraduate and graduate programs at American Advanced Technicians Institute. 0% of these degrees were awarded to women, and 100% awarded men. The most common race/ethnicity group of degree recipients was hispanic or latino (8 degrees).

Costs

After taking grants and loans into account, the average net price for students is $44,484.

In 2024, 94% of undergraduate students attending American Advanced Technicians Institute received financial aid through grants. Comparatively, 80% of undergraduate students received financial aid through loans.

In 2024, 22% of students graduating from American Advanced Technicians Institute completed their program within 100% "normal time" (i.e. 4 years for a 4-year degree). Comparatively, 87% completed their degrees within 150% of the normal time, and 87% within 200%.

The following chart shows these completion rates over time compared to the average for the Carnegie Classification group.

Graduation rate is defined as the percentage of full-time, first-time students who received a degree or award within a specific percentage of "normal time" to completion for their program.
